Understanding the Condition

What is IVDD?

Spinal conditions are among the most common neurological problems seen in dogs, and Intervertebral Disc Disease is the most frequently diagnosed of them. They affect mobility, coordination, strength and quality of life — but with early intervention and structured physiotherapy, many dogs make remarkable recoveries.

IVDD occurs when the cushioning discs between the vertebrae degenerate, bulge or rupture into the spinal canal. Those discs normally act as shock absorbers. When they fail, pressure is placed on the spinal cord or nerve roots — causing pain, weakness and sometimes paralysis.

Hansen Type I

Sudden, explosive rupture

Common in chondrodystrophic breeds such as Dachshunds and French Bulldogs. Acute, severe symptoms that often appear over hours.

Hansen Type II

Slow, chronic bulge

Seen more often in larger breeds, with a gradual onset of weakness that can be mistaken for age or stiffness.

IVDD is graded I–V by severity of neurological signs

The grade shapes both the treatment route and the realistic outlook — it's the first thing I'll want to know from your vet.

What IVDD does to posture

IVDD commonly shows up in how a dog holds themselves. The head and neck drop, the spine roaches into a kyphotic arch, weight shifts forward onto the front end, and the muscles along the back tighten while the hindquarter muscles waste away.

That posture is a large part of what I assess and what I treat. It's also the clearest way to track progress: as the pain settles and the hindquarters get stronger, the arch flattens and the head comes up. If dogs are allowed to keep this compensatory posture this increases the risk of further injury.

Which dogs are most at risk?

Chondrodystrophic breeds — those with abnormally short limbs due to differences in cartilage development — are genetically predisposed, and their discs calcify earlier in life. That said, any dog can develop IVDD.

Other Spinal Conditions

Other Conditions I Can Help With

Alongside IVDD I work with dogs diagnosed with a range of other spinal and neurological conditions. Each needs a tailored approach — but all benefit significantly from structured physiotherapy.

🩸

Fibrocartilaginous Embolism (FCE)

Fibrocartilage from a disc enters the blood supply to the spinal cord, causing sudden loss of function. Typically non-painful after the initial event. Physio is central to neurological recovery — many dogs improve significantly with intensive rehabilitation.

ANNPE

Acute Non-Compressive Nucleus Pulposus Extrusion — a high-velocity disc extrusion causing sudden, often severe neurological signs without ongoing compression. Managed conservatively, which makes physiotherapy the primary treatment driving recovery.

🔻

Degenerative Lumbosacral Stenosis

Also called cauda equina syndrome. Compression of the nerve roots in the lower back, causing hindlimb weakness, pain on rising, reluctance to jump and sometimes tail or bladder dysfunction. Physio supports pain management and strengthening alongside medical or surgical treatment.

🦴

Spondylosis Deformans

A degenerative condition where bony bridges form along the spine, typically causing stiffness and reduced mobility rather than neurological deficits. Manual therapy, targeted strengthening and laser therapy are particularly effective here.

📉

Degenerative Myelopathy (DM)

A progressive, non-painful spinal cord disease causing gradual hindlimb weakness and eventually paralysis — most common in German Shepherds, Corgis and Boxers. There is no cure, but physiotherapy slows progression and keeps dogs mobile for longer.

Recognising the Signs

Warning Signs of IVDD

IVDD can come on suddenly — particularly Type I — or worsen gradually over weeks. Early intervention is one of the most important factors in how well a dog recovers.

😣

Pain & Sensitivity

Yelping when touched or picked up, flinching, hunched posture, or visible tension through the back and neck. Your dog may resist turning their head or lowering their nose to the ground.

🐕

Wobbly or Uncoordinated Gait

Stumbling, crossing the legs when walking, or appearing drunk. This ataxia is caused by disrupted signals between the spinal cord and the limbs, affecting balance and coordination.

Weakness or Paralysis

Reduced ability or complete inability to bear weight on one or more limbs. The hind limbs are most commonly affected. Some dogs drag their back legs or knuckle over on their paws.

🚽

Bladder & Bowel Changes

Difficulty urinating, dribbling urine, or incontinence. Straining to defecate or loss of bowel control — signs that the nerves controlling these functions are being compressed.

🏃

Reluctance to Move

Refusing stairs or jumping, hesitation when rising from rest, morning stiffness, or unwillingness to do exercise that was previously enjoyed.

😴

Behavioural Changes

Unusual lethargy, loss of appetite, changed temperament, or seeming generally not themselves. Chronic pain is often expressed as personality change rather than obvious distress.

⚠️ This one is an emergency. If your dog suddenly cannot walk, has lost control of their bladder or bowel, or you suspect loss of deep pain sensation — contact your vet immediately. In Grade IV–V IVDD, time to treatment directly affects recovery potential. The sooner decompression and rehabilitation begin, the better the outcome.
Treatment & Recovery

How Physiotherapy Helps

Physiotherapy is central to IVDD recovery — supporting conservative management and post-operative rehabilitation alike. A structured programme addresses every consequence of spinal cord injury: pain, muscle loss, coordination deficits and reduced mobility.

The overarching aim is to promote neuroplasticity — the nervous system's ability to reorganise, rebuild damaged pathways and form new connections — while systematically restoring the strength and movement needed for a good quality of life.

What I Do in Sessions

⚡ Electrotherapy — TENS & NMES
TENS helps manage pain by interrupting pain signals at the spinal level. NMES sends targeted impulses directly to muscles that can no longer receive normal nerve signals — preventing atrophy and maintaining muscle mass during early recovery.
🔴 Laser Therapy (Photobiomodulation)
Therapeutic laser stimulates cellular energy production in damaged tissue, reducing neurogenic inflammation and accelerating tissue repair. It enhances axonal regrowth and reduces scar tissue formation along the spinal cord.
🤲 Manual Therapy & Massage
Hands-on techniques address secondary pain and stiffness in compensating muscles and joints. Passive range of motion exercises maintain joint health and provide vital sensory input to the nervous system.
🔵 Proprioception & Balance Training
Balance boards, wobble cushions, cavaletti poles and weight-shifting exercises retrain the nervous system to interpret and respond to sensory information correctly, improving coordination and confidence.
🏋️ Progressive Strengthening
A carefully graduated programme rebuilds the epaxial (back) and hindlimb muscles that weaken rapidly with neurological injury. Every exercise is tailored to the dog's current grade and progressed at the right pace.

The Evidence Base

What the Research Shows

The case for early, structured physiotherapy in IVDD recovery is well supported by peer-reviewed research. The evidence consistently shows that rehabilitation improves neurological outcomes compared with rest alone.

📊

Faster Return to Walking

Dogs receiving intensive physiotherapy after IVDD surgery regain the ability to walk significantly faster than those managed with rest alone — particularly in Grades III and IV.

🧬

Neuroplasticity & Axonal Regrowth

Targeted sensorimotor stimulation promotes axonal sprouting and synaptic reorganisation in the injured spinal cord. Early movement is now understood as a key driver of neurological recovery, not just a consequence of it.

💪

Preventing Muscle Loss

Dogs with IVDD lose significant muscle mass within weeks without rehabilitation. Electrotherapy combined with active and passive exercise substantially reduces this neurogenic atrophy.

🎯

Conservative Management Success

For Grades I–II, physiotherapy-supported conservative management achieves outcomes comparable to surgery in many cases. Structured intensive rehab is the key — cage rest alone produces significantly worse results.

🔄

Reducing Recurrence Risk

Core strengthening and ongoing body condition management are associated with reduced risk of future disc events. Dogs who complete a full rehabilitation programme show improved long-term spinal stability.

🔴

Laser Therapy Evidence

Multiple studies confirm that photobiomodulation reduces neuroinflammation, promotes axonal regeneration and enhances myelination. Neuroprotective effects are strongest when treatment begins in the acute phase.

✓ Full Recovery Cervical Disc Extrusion / Paralysis

🐾 Toffee

Paralysed from a cervical disc extrusion. Barely any movement in her front limbs.

The Problem

Toffee became paralysed due to a disc extrusion in her neck. She had ventral slot decompression surgery and came to me with just some movement in her front limbs — unable to walk or stand.

The Approach

Intensive rehabilitation over several weeks, building on small improvements session by session. Every tiny gain was used as a foundation for the next stage of recovery.

Outcome

Toffee is now a completely normal dog — walking, running, living life. You wouldn't know she was ever paralysed. Early, consistent rehabilitation gives the best chance of neurological recovery.

✓ Walking Again Severe IVDD / L3–L4 Emergency Surgery

🐾 Rosie

Post L3/L4 disc extrusion surgery (2025), plus previous IVDD surgery (2023). Complete hind limb paralysis.

The Problem

Rosie lost all movement and sensation in her hind legs following a severe L3/L4 disc extrusion requiring emergency spinal surgery. She had also had IVDD surgery in 2023.

The Approach

Carefully structured physiotherapy focusing on posture correction, neurological re-education, strength building and coordination — with consistent home exercise work.

Outcome

Rosie progressed from complete hind limb paralysis to walking independently again. Recovery after spinal surgery is rarely linear — but consistent rehab, patience and commitment can completely change the outcome.
